Choosing the Right Sealant
When selecting a sealant for wood stove pipe joints, look for a product specifically designed for high-temperature applications, typically rated up to 2000°F (1093°C). Some popular options include high-temperature ceramic rope, refractory sealants like Cerablanket, and specialized pipe sealants like PipeSeal. Make sure to read and follow the manufacturer’s instructions for application and curing times.
Preparing the Pipe Joints
Before assembling the pipe joints, ensure a clean and dry environment. Cut the pipe to the desired length, using a pipe cutter or a hacksaw, and deburr the edges with a file or a deburring tool. Clean the pipe and flange surfaces with a wire brush to remove any debris or oxidation. Apply a thin layer of sealant to the joint, using a putty knife or a caulk gun, and assemble the pipe sections according to the manufacturer’s instructions.
Assembling and Curing the Joints
Once the pipe sections are assembled, use a pipe wrench or a flange wrench to tighten the bolts to the recommended torque specification, usually around 20-30 ft-lbs. Leave the sealant to cure for the recommended time, typically 24 hours or overnight, before exposing the pipe to heat or operation. After curing, inspect the joint for any signs of leakage and reapply sealant as needed.
